MANY WOMEN ARE UNFIT TO BE WIVES EVEN AT THE AGE OF 28 - MOUNT ZION DIRECTOR MIKE BAMILOYE
Evangelist Mike Bamiloye, the founder of Mount Zion Faith Ministries, has stated that many women, even at the age of 28, are not prepared to be housewives.
According to him, many women nowadays "prepare more for the wedding day than for the marriage life."
This was recently expressed by the Gospel filmmaker in a lengthy Instagram post.
The clergyman said, "They (some ladies) are too hasty and not ready to sit down and learn the principles of marital life.
"Many ladies are not qualified to be wives even at 28.
"They can't cook properly. They are used to fast food at the eateries and ice cream and indomie and spaghetti plus boiled eggs and Titus, and they spend six months studying the wedding gowns and the accessories for the bridal trails. And they want to marry."
He said his sister is 26, but "she is still not yet a wife material."
He recognized that she is pretty but cannot cook, is not spiritually strong, and has a limited understanding of God's word
The cleric wondered how such a lady could "withstand the spiritual challenges that come against every home."
.
According to Bamiloye, his sister is extremely materialistic and lacks expertise of household administration.
He remembered one of his sister's friends getting married and buying a cookbook on her way to her husband's place.
